    About Miloranka

    Miloranka, a name steeped in Proto-Slavic warmth, carries the gentle echoes of "gracious" and "dear." It's a choice for parents who appreciate a soft, earthy feel and a connection to rich European heritage, yet desire something truly distinct. While names like Mila have found global popularity, Miloranka retains a rare charm, offering a full, melodious sound that feels both familiar and refreshingly uncommon. It speaks to a family who cherishes a name with deep roots and a gentle disposition, one that stands out without being overtly trendy, perfectly suiting a child with a serene and kind spirit.
